Plain-English summary

The service states it does not sell or rent personal data for money. However, with user consent, specific personal data (excluding health data) may be shared with third-party marketing and analytics platforms to improve advertising campaigns. The service also reserves the right to receive personal data from other third parties to enhance user experience and gather analytics.

Third-party sharing for marketing without health data

With user consent, Flo may share information such as technical identifiers (IP address, device IDs, advertising IDs), age group, subscription status, and app launch data with mobile app marketing and analytics platforms like AppsFlyer, Firebase, and TikTok Ad Manager to improve advertising campaigns and understand performance. Health data is not shared for marketing purposes.

Why it matters: Your technical identifiers, age group, subscription status, and information about launching the App may be shared with third-party marketing and analytics platforms for promotional purposes if you provide consent. Your health data is explicitly stated not to be shared for marketing.

With your consent, Flo may collect and share information with AppsFlyer and its partners, Firebase and TikTok Ad Manager. These are mobile app marketing and analytics platforms (not social media platforms) who help us improve our advertising campaigns, understand the performance of our campaigns and spread the word about Flo. They may also use information collected to remind you to revisit the App if you haven’t used it in a while.

Commitment to GDPR-level privacy rights globally

Regardless of residence, all users are provided with privacy rights equivalent to those afforded under the GDPR, which is stated to be the highest standard for data protection globally.

Why it helps: Users are guaranteed a high standard of data protection, as the company commits to providing GDPR-level privacy rights to all users, regardless of where they live.

Regardless of where you live, we’re committed to providing you the same privacy rights afforded under the GDPR, which is generally regarded as the highest standard for data protection globally.

Right to access and portability of personal data

Users have the right to know what personal data is processed about them, request access to all of it, and receive a copy in a structured and portable format (.json files). iOS Flo Premium members can also download a report directly from the App.

Why it helps: You can easily obtain a copy of your personal data in a usable format and understand what data the service holds about you, which supports data control and migration.

You have the right to know what personal data we process about you. You can request access to all your personal data and to receive a copy of it, including in a structured and portable form (we use .json files). For iOS Flo Premium members, the App also allows you to download a report with some of your personal data directly.

Right to erase personal data

Users can request to delete their personal data at any time. While deletion may affect some features, the process involves unlinking personal identifiers immediately, even if some data temporarily remains in backup systems for up to 90 days.

Why it helps: You can request that your personal data be deleted at any time, giving you control over your information, with clear communication about what happens during the deletion process.

You can ask us to delete your personal data at any time. Keep in mind that deleting some personal data might affect your experience with certain features that depend on historic information.

Explicit commitment against selling personal data for money

The service explicitly states that it does not sell or rent personal data for money and will only share it as outlined in the privacy policy, including with service providers. It also specifically commits not to use information from Apple HealthKit or Google Health Connect for advertising or sell it to advertising platforms, data brokers, or resellers.

Why it helps: This commitment provides assurance that your personal data, especially sensitive health data from third-party integrations, will not be sold or rented for monetary gain, providing a higher level of privacy protection.

**No sale of personal data:**we do not sell or rent your personal data for money. We will only share your personal data as outlined in this Privacy Policy. This includes sharing your personal data with our service providers who help us operate our Services. We will not use information from Apple HealthKit or Google Health Connect for advertising or sell it to advertising platforms, data brokers or resellers.
